Limestone forms when shells sand and mud are deposited at the bottom of oceans and lakes and over time solidify into rock. Marble is a metamorphic rock composed of recrystallized carbonate minerals most commonly calcite or dolomite marble is typically not foliated although there are exceptions in geology the term marble refers to metamorphosed limestone but its use in stonemasonry more broadly encompasses unmetamorphosed limestone. The main difference between limestone and marble is that limestone is a sedimentary rock typically composed of calcium carbonate fossils and marble is a metamorphic rock. Marble is a metamorphic rock that forms when limestone is subjected to the heat and pressure of metamorphism. Limestone is a carbonate sedimentary rock that is often composed of the skeletal fragments of marine organisms such as coral foraminifera and molluscs its major materials are the minerals calcite and aragonite which are different crystal forms of calcium carbonate caco 3 a closely related rock is dolomite which contains a high percentage of the mineral dolomite camg co 3 2.
